Vibrant Artifacts from the Jerusalem Temple

The Jerusalem Temple was a sacred place that housed many precious artifacts, each with its own unique story. Among the most famous are the golden menorah, a seven-branched lampstand that symbolizes the light of the divine presence, and the Ark of the Covenant, which contained the stone tablets of the Ten Commandments. The temple also featured intricate carvings on the walls and columns, depicting scenes from the Bible and the history of the Jewish people.
